Khirki Population - Korea, Chhattisgarh

Khirki is a medium size village located in Bharatpur Tehsil of Korea district, Chhattisgarh with total 177 families residing. The Khirki village has population of 570 of which 295 are males while 275 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Khirki village population of children with age 0-6 is 90 which makes up 15.79 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Khirki village is 932 which is lower than Chhattisgarh state average of 991. Child Sex Ratio for the Khirki as per census is 731, lower than Chhattisgarh average of 969.

Khirki village has lower literacy rate compared to Chhattisgarh. In 2011, literacy rate of Khirki village was 60.21 % compared to 70.28 % of Chhattisgarh. In Khirki Male literacy stands at 74.49 % while female literacy rate was 45.57 %.

Caste Factor

Khirki village of Korea has substantial population of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 25.79 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 1.58 % of total population in Khirki village.

Work Profile

In Khirki village out of total population, 262 were engaged in work activities. 11.83 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 88.17 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 262 workers engaged in Main Work, 10 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 1 were Agricultural labourer.
